ebm-papst becomes part of Madison Air – new strong owner for a long-term successful future
– The three shareholder families transfer ebm-papst to Madison Air, a leading US provider of air quality solutions
– Shareholders see Madison as an ideal partner for the group's further growth
– ebm-papst and Madison Air combine their strengths and complement each other technologically, geographically, and operationally to a high degree
– ebm-papst will benefit from Madison's innovative strength and strong presence in the USA
– Mulfingen remains the headquarters of ebm-papst and an important location for research, development, and production
– The new owner aims to strengthen ebm-papst in the long term and is ready to invest in the group and its employees
The ebm-papst Group ("ebm-papst"), a global leader in innovative ventilation solutions for air, refrigeration, and air conditioning technology, and the US corporation Madison Air ("Madison", NYSE: MAIR) announced today the acquisition of ebm-papst by Madison. The shareholder families of ebm-papst have signed an agreement with Madison Air, a global provider of air quality solutions, for the transfer of their shares. With Madison, ebm-papst gains a long-term oriented new owner with high innovation capacity and operational scaling experience to accelerate its growth. Conversely, Madison gains access to innovative air technology and highly attractive markets, especially in Europe, allowing it to further scale its business outside North America. As part of the transaction, ebm-papst is valued at €5.1 billion (Enterprise Value).
Madison Air is a leading provider of advanced air quality solutions for mission-critical applications. With its market-leading brands, the company serves a broad customer base across various end markets, including healthcare, industrial high-performance manufacturing, cleanrooms, data centers, and residential buildings. ebm-papst will complement this portfolio with its ventilation and motor technology, engineering expertise, and excellent reputation with customers, especially in Europe and Asia. Madison Air conducts the vast majority of its business in its home market of the USA and gains new market access in Europe through ebm-papst. Madison's operational expertise will support ebm-papst in further developing its manufacturing, supply chains, and commercial implementation, enabling it to continue its growth trajectory at an even faster pace. Additionally, ebm-papst will gain access to the US capital market through the partnership.

Madison Air aims to strengthen ebm-papst long-term with its more than 13,000 employees worldwide, including around 5,800 in Germany, and is prepared for additional investments. Mulfingen remains the group's headquarters and an important location for research, development, and production. The transaction does not affect existing employment obligations, collective agreements, or works council arrangements.

Focus on future topics pays off
The global expansion of digital infrastructures and advances in artificial intelligence create a rapidly increasing demand for highly efficient, scalable cooling solutions. ebm-papst combines physical products and digital platforms into intelligent integrated systems. To realize growth opportunities in these markets, sustainable investments, global scalability, and speed of implementation are required.
ebm-papst is already well aligned with the structural growth drivers: data centers, AI infrastructure, electrification, energy efficiency, and sustainable heating and cooling solutions. The AI-based platform NEXAIRA enables demand-driven control, predictive maintenance, and a significant reduction in energy consumption in data centers.
The shareholder families were supported in this transaction by Milbank LLP as legal advisors and Goldman Sachs Bank Europe SE as financial advisors. The transaction is subject to regulatory approvals and usual closing conditions. The completion of the transaction is expected by the end of 2026.
